Martial law is having a bad effect on the fleet as ships are refusing to resupply Galactica. The Chief is arrested as a suspected Cylon, and it's up to Gaius Baltar to prove his innocence. The President, with the assistance of Lee Adama, escapes her imprisonment aboard Galactica and takes refuge on Cloud 9 with the help of the most unlikely of allies.
Starbuck and Helo discover a group of fifty-three survivors on Caprica.

In a distant part of the universe, a civilization of humans live on planets known as the Twelve Colonies. In the past, the Colonies have been at war with a cybernetic race known as the Cylons.
40 years after the first war the Cylons launch a devastating attack on the Colonies. The only military ship that survived the attack takes up the task of leading a small fugitive fleet of survivors into space in search of a fabled refuge known as Earth.
